Door locks open by themselves randomly

1996 Mercury Sable-LS Wagon
The doors locks open after being locked -- whether I use the remote key lock or the door lock switch in the car. It happens on a random basis.

I would check the armrest controls for a bad switch, or a door pin switch that is corroded and not releasing all the way when door is open. Many systems do not allow locking if there is a "door ajar" situation. On a sedan, this condition seems to oddly occur most on rear passenger doors.

Any errors or problems that mount up, make diagnostics harder and more expensive. ignoring many problems will result in a much larger diagnostic bill later, so best to maintain all systems.

Ignition lock cylinder has a key-minder circuit. This must be working correctly on most cars for the keyless entry to effectively lock the vehicle. Intermittent ignition lock "buzzing" when doors are closed, and key is in lock position must be resolved

Some possibilities

The power door locks may self-activate or cycle on some vehicles. This may be caused by a misadjusted front door lock linkage, excess solder in the front door power window switch, water infiltration of a potential open wire harness connector inside the front doors, wiring harness chafe on the door check strap, or a damaged Remote Keyless Entry (RKE) key fob.

Step by step reset the door remote control lexus 400LS

1. sitting in driver seat, with driver's door OPEN, press lock/unlock button ON THE DRIVERS DOOR to lock all doors, then manually unlock driver door only.
2. Insert YOUR key in ignition, DO NOT TURN, then remove key.
3. Using the same lock/unlock button ON THE DRIVERS DOOR, slowly press lock-unlock in 5 cycles
4. Shut door.
5. Open door.
6. Using the same lock/unlock button ON THE DRIVERS DOOR, again slowly press lock-unlock in 5 cycles
7. With the door open insert your key into the ignition, turn to 'on' position (DON'T START), wait 5 seconds. Turn off and remove key.
8. Locks should cycle once (Car will lock and then unlock once by herself). If they don't cycle or they cycle more than once, do steps 1-7 over.
9. Now using the remote, push lock button, hold for one second, then release the button. The locks should cycle once. If not, start over and go slower.
10. Close the door.
11. Open the door.
12. Press the lock button on the remote. The locks should do a lock-unlock cycle.
13. Close the door
14. Press the lock button on the remote, the doors should lock.
15. Press unlock button and the doors should unlock.

96 sable wagon keyless entry

Try re-programing the system.
These are the instructions from the service manual.

. Turn ignition from OFF to RUN 5 times within 10 seconds, with the 5th time ending
in RUN. Door locks will cycle to confirm programming mode.

2. Within 20 seconds press any button on first keyless remote. Door locks will cycle
to confirm programming.

3. Within 20 seconds, press any button on second keyless remote. Door locks will
cycle again to confirm programming.

4. Turn ignition to OFF. Locks will again cycle to indicate end of programming mode.

Program keyless remote for 94 Grand Marquis

On this model you will have to open glove box and press the tabs on each side so that you can open it all the way open. You will see a 2 wire grey connector behind it.
Turn ignition switch to run postion then take a paper clip or something like that and momentarily short the 2 wires together.
The door locks should then cycle from lock to unlock.Remove the paper clip then press one of the buttons on each remote. When you press the button on the remote door locks should cycle again to confirm that it programed.Then when finished turn off the ignition switch and door locks should unlock to confirm you have exited programming mode.

Program remote keyless entry

1) Turn key from OFF to ON eight times within 10 seconds ending in the ON position.

2) After doors lock then unlock, press any button on the
remote being programmed.

3) The doors should lock/unlock to confirm programming.

4) Turn key to OFF and door locks should cycle one last time.
